WordPress: Tendência ou Certeza?
Apesar de ter migrado do WordPress.com para o Blogspot, ao WP.org só sobra elogios. Nessa minha “nova” caminhada de desenvolvimento Web, tenho me deparado com algumas situações que um dia, mas UM dia já imaginaria passar, situação de ser um Designer e Programador, ou seja, um Web Developer. Tinha plena certeza que um dia isso [...]
Apesar de ter migrado do WordPress.com para o Blogspot, ao WP.org só sobra elogios. Nessa minha “nova” caminhada de desenvolvimento Web, tenho me deparado com algumas situações que um dia, mas UM dia já imaginaria passar, situação de ser um Designer e Programador, ou seja, um Web Developer.
Tinha plena certeza que um dia isso iria acontecer, mas não dá maneira que está acontecendo. Desenvolvendo em cima de uma API, ainda mais do WordPress que era tachado como limitado por próximas pessoas vãs, confesso que até eu olhei com um ar de desconfiança.
Mas…
…com o WordPress.org só encontrei vantagens. Desenvolver um Blog, Site, Hotsite e até para os mais otimistas um Portal. É isso mesmo pessoal, o WordPress.org pra quem ainda desconfia é fato, real e funciona.
Na “antiguidade” você construía um layout, ou seja, uma estrutura de página como essa do evento de arquitetura de informação que ocorrerá em São Paulo em Outubro. A mesma foi construída usando somente o WordPress, nem parece não é? Formulário de contato, Comentários, “Notícias”, tudo pelo WP sem ajuda de qualquer programador para fazer isso, estava pronto. O Designer só cuidou do visual da página e da edição do CSS, HTML e inserção dos plugins necessários.
“Isto permite que páginas de conteúdo sejam criadas e gerenciadas fora da cronologia normal do blog e foi o primeiro passo além do simples software gerenciador de blog para ser um CMS completo” – Wikipedia
Sistemas de tags, envio de e-mail, comentários, destaques de matérias, galerias de imagens (integração com flickr), mais postados, mais lidos, lista de favoritos, enquête, newsletter, busca, contador de acesso e até sistema de vendas online (shopping virtual). Tudo isso pronto, é só baixar os plugins, copiar dentro do diretório específico e pronto.
Você consegue ganhar em qualidade, tempo de desenvolvimento e ainda economiza uma grana com pessoal para desenvolvimento, podendo investir a mesma no desenvolvimento de mais ferramentas para API para utilização de todos.
Uma das grandes vantagens de se usar API para desenvolvimento, é a facilidade em se manter os padrões, modelos em projetos. É sempre difícil em uma organização, ainda mais se tratando de Web, seguir uma linha para todos sites, umas vez que diversos desenvolvedores deixam de usar o que já foi feito anteriormente.
E com o crescimento de sites desenvolvidos dentro dos padrões, ou seja, dentro das especificações da W3C, essas ferramentas tendem a crescer cada vez mais, uma vez que esta padronização vem à tona “alavancada” pela famosa Web Semântica.
Agora fico me perguntando. As API’s como WordPress é uma tendência ou é certeza? As agências, empresas e outros irão optar cada vez mais por essas ferramentas ao invés de contratar programadores e programadores?
A minha resposta é SIM. Se estou errado, só o tempo dirá.
Então é isso ai pessoal, concluo esse post com o incentivo de investirmos nesse tipo de desenvolvimento, nessas ferramentas que só acrescentam benefícios para nós desenvolvedores.
O post está aberto a discussões, tem muito a acrescentar nesse texto.
Sinceramente não sou muito a favor da API do wordpress. Tenho que admitir que ela é bem flexivel em alguns aspectos, porém acredito mesmo que a tendencia é utilizar programadores, quando a solução demandar requisitos muito específicos.
[Responder]
Bom …
estou começando agora nesse rumo de programador, e designer, mas vejo um crescimento muito grande na distribuiçao das coisas, e a forma facil de se aprender que o WP utiliza.
o API eu achei uma forma simples e facil de se utilizar, e tbm como se pode fazer para simplismente integrar um plugn no seu trabalho.
Logo teremos mais uma pagina criada pelo Eder em WP.
WEBtvCN.fr
Flw
[Responder]
o wordpress é muito bom mesmo eder, com ele também evitamos de fazer programação chata e repetitiva … kkkkkkk
mas NÃO ACHO que programadores se tornaram obsoleto e nem que é uma antiguidade fazer a programação de seu site .. os sistemas de CMS podem ter diminuido a necessidade de se programar, e é possível fazer muita coisa com o wordpress, mas dificilmente será melhor que um sistema feito sobe medida por bons profissionais, mesmo com todos os plugins … plugin que pode ter sido feito por qualquer pseudo programador … kkkkk
[Responder]
realmente o WP é uma ótima alternativa, mas concordo com o “humberto” e “marco moura”. Para alguns trabalhos específicos não tem como dispensar o trabalho em conjunto entre designers e programadores.
[Responder]
Gostei dos comentários, superou minhas expectativas.
Concordo com o Humberto, Marco e o Robson, mas eu acho que seria interessante todos, programadores e designer trabalharmos na construção da ampliação dessa ferramenta.
E quando necessitarmos de algo específico, construímos o módulo (plugin) e disponibilizamos para outros.
Todos trabalhando em prol do crescimento da Comunidade.
[Responder]
Éder,
Você levantou uma questão interessante: até onde podemos chegar com as APIs?
No meu blog, eu escrevi um artigo sobre APIs. Independente do sistema, eu acredito que tudo depende da necessidade do cliente. Frameworks são excelentes formas de se agilizar processos de desenvolvimento, porém sempre haverá uma limitação. Por mais completo que um framework seja, sempre haverá algo que fará falta.
Eu acredito que o mais importante aliado na utilização de frameworks e APIs é a criatividade do desenvolvedor.
[Responder]
2 de setembro de 2009
Olá Cadu!
Eu também acredito que as API’s são excelentes, todavia, noto que não só eu como todos que até agora comentaram esse post que encontramos limitações nessas ferramentas.
Coisas específicas a fazer existirão, mas não podemos esquecer que API é uma Interface de Programação de Aplicaticos, ou seja, se falta algo espefífico nela, podemos contribuir com o crescimento da mesma.
Valeu pelo comentário, meu desejo nesse artigo é esse mesmo, levantar essa questão: Até onde podemos chegar com as APIs?
[Responder]